PLAN …A switch-mode AC-DC power supply. Almost every low-voltage device needs a power supply to function. These devices operate on DC voltage which isn’t directly available from the AC sockets in buildings and our homes. An AC-DC power supply is designed to convert and lower AC mains to a safe and suitable level of DC for low-voltage components.

The layout …The hot loop is formed by MOSFETs M1 and M2 and the decoupling capacitor C IN. The switching actions of M1 and M2 cause HF di/dt and dv/dt noise. C IN provides a low impedance path to bypass the HF noisy content. Learn some of …Once the initial specs of a DC-DC design are selected (e.g., input voltage range, output voltage, output current), the first step is to select a converter IC. The desired DC-DC topology will narrow this choice. If the input voltage is greater than the output voltage, choose a buck (i.e., step-down) topology.

Advertisement.Decoupling Capacitor Recommendations X7R or X5R capacitors are recommended with a rated voltage > 6.3V. 0603 or a smaller size is recommended. Pick capacitors with low ESL and ESR. It is important to place decoupling caps as close to the target supply balls while maintaining > 20 mil trace width for supply connections to capacitor SMT pads.

A flyback power supply involves using a transformer to store energy from the primary winding and relay the stored energy to the secondary winding.
